What Causes an Oil Pan Gasket to Malfunction in Cars?

A car's oil pan gasket may fail for a number of reasons, such as deterioration of the material, poor installation, oil leaks, thermal expansion, flaws in the design, vibration, and oil quality. To prevent these issues, regular inspections, proper installation, high-quality parts, timely oil changes, and prompt leaks are essential. Understanding these causes and taking preventive measures can help maintain the longevity and proper functioning of the oil pan gasket, ensuring the health of your vehicle's engine.

  1. Thermostats

    Thermostats regulate engine temperature by controlling coolant flow to the radiator. They are crucial because of their impact on engine efficiency and protection.

  2. Grilles

    Grilles protect the radiator and engine compartment while allowing airflow to cool it and keep debris out.
